  • Sing Me to Sleep, Gabi Burton
    Bloomsbury, 9781547610372, June 27, 2023 (Young Adult)

    Sing Me to Sleep is a fantasy novel you can sink into and finish in a day. The will-they-won’t-they banter and chemistry between Saoirse and the Prince will give you goosebumps. Not to mention the non-stop fight to overthrow a corrupt kingdom is sure to have you frantically turning the pages and gasping at the twists and turns along the way.”

    —Jody Hardy, Mostly Books, Tucson, AZ

    “A thrilling YA utilizing a different interpretation of siren folklore. In a world of BIPOC characters, a siren assassin named Saoirse is torn between her natural killer instinct and her feelings toward the prince of the kingdom. As supernatural segregation, internal politics, and a plotted insurrection bubbles to the surface, the protagonist is forced to choose sides. Literary fantasy meets Black amplified voices in this unique teen novel that centers POC characters.”

    —Gerard Villegas, Auntie’s Bookstore, Spokane, WA

About ABA

The American Booksellers Association, a national not-for-profit trade organization, works with booksellers and industry partners to ensure the success and profitability of independently owned book retailers, and to assist in expanding the community of the book.

Independent bookstores act as community anchors; they serve a unique role in promoting the open exchange of ideas, enriching the cultural life of communities, and creating economically vibrant neighborhoods.
